jmeter录制脚本-使用代理录制jmeter脚本

暖兮 暖兮     2022-08-09     504

关键词:

这一节先介绍下对于Jmeter自带的脚本录制方法

使用代理录制Jmeter脚本

首先,Jmeter脚本是以JMX格式为主

那怎么样通过jmeter来录制脚本呢,

录制脚本前,我们只要启动好代理,手动通过IE或者火狐来录制,录制完停止代理。

上面的是思路,下面这边就启动下代理,启动代理前需要设置Jmeter一些配置需求

1.首先先创建一个线程组

2.在该线程组当中创建一个 Http请求默认值

3.在添加的http请求默认值中设置你要录制的服务器IP地址或者域名

4.添加好需要录制的域名或者IP后,在工作台中添加“HTTP代理服务器”

5.添加好代理服务器后,目标控制器 指定在线程组下,代理服务器的默认端口为8080,只要不跟本机的其他端口冲突即可,否则录制不到jmeter脚本

也可以通过cmd命令窗口查看运行的端口是否存在8080

6.然后在代理服务器中过滤掉我们不要录制的内容或者只录制的内容,正则表达式: .*\.gif

7.添加需要录制的内容后,点击启动Jmeter代理

8.然后打开IE浏览器设置本机的代理,注意端口要一致,如果是其他机器的,请修改IP地址。注意两台机器都要有jmeter

IE浏览器设置代理,Internet选项——连接——局域网设置

 

设置好之后,点击确定,如果是首次配置会出现缺少证书,需要安装下

 

 

按照上面的步骤安装完成之后,在IE浏览器上输入需要测试的网站名称,进入后输入帐号密码登录,童鞋们可以看到右侧的Jmeter自动同步出来了在IE操作的步骤

这样就已经录制成功了,右边一条一条的信息就是所谓的脚本啦,录制成功后,记得关闭代理服务器!!!!!!

当然这些脚本有些是冗余的,或者没必要存在的,那么就需要对这些脚本进行精简化,那么下一节会讲到如何去精简脚本!

其实童鞋们如果按照流程操作下来可以发现,使用Jmeter代理服务器非常的麻烦,非常的不方便,所以我们通常都是使用badboy去录制脚本来使用,下一节小七就为大家介绍下Badboy录制脚本后在Jmeter中的使用以及如何对脚本的精简!

jmeter_使用ie代理录制脚本

  因为项目登录的密码需要RSA加密,选用了jmeter作为压测工具;  就自己本次项目,顺便学习Jmeter,做一个简单的记录,本文主要介绍使用IE代理录制脚本;  自己也尝试过使用Badboy录制,还是喜欢代理录制,毕竟直接使... 查看详情

jmeter之录制脚本

上一节已经已经介绍过Jmeter代理使用,对于web测试的话,经常会用到一些脚本去执行某些功能,也就是所谓的半自动化测试,对于不懂代码的童鞋来说,脚本是一个很头疼的概念,badboy的录制是一个对于刚接触脚本的人来讲是一... 查看详情

jmeter测试实例(使用jmeter录制脚本)

         JMETER测试实例(使用Jmeter录制脚本)一般使用Jmeter脚本有两种方式,一种是使用Jmeter代理服务器,一种是使用bodboy录制脚本,今天先介绍第一种方式 1.建立测试计划    ... 查看详情

1.2jmeter使用代理录制脚本

参考文档:http://jingyan.baidu.com/article/4e5b3e19333ff191911e2459.html  利用JMeter配置代理:1、添加线程组:  TestPlan->Add->Threads(Users)->ThreadGroup2、添加HTTP请求默认:  ThreadGroup- 查看详情

jmeter自学笔记6----脚本录制

 有两种录制方式:一种是使用JMter代理录制(不推荐使用,比较麻烦),第二种是使用Badboy录制。Http请求+查看结果树 代理服务器操作步骤(一)创建一个线程组(右键点击“测试计划”--->“添加”--->“线程组”)... 查看详情

使用jmeter录制脚本及录制脚本的优化

...--添加--线程(用户)--线程组2.添加HTTP代理服务器(即把jmeter当做代理服务器)3.设置代理服务器①设置端口;②设置TestPlanCreation中的目标控制器(改为测试计划>线程组)注意不修改代理服务器启动时可能会报错;③设置Reque... 查看详情

jmeter代理录制脚本方式

  通过JMeter的代理功能,录制https网站这里注意:需要在排除模式中用.*.(js|css|PNG|jpg|ico|png|gif).*因为实际的请求是:https://172.16.87.177:7001/portal/sso.login?SSOLOGOUT=true 设置浏览器代理:启动JMeter的代理服务器,设置排除模式... 查看详情

Jmeter - 脚本录制

】Jmeter-脚本录制【英文标题】:Jmeter-scriptrecording【发布时间】:2016-09-0509:03:18【问题描述】:我是Jmeter的新手,正在尝试自己学习它。我正在浏览器中设置代理设置并尝试记录脚本。但是一旦我在浏览器中设置了代理,就无法... 查看详情

jmeter录制手机脚本

前提:已安装Java,已下载Jmeter,手机网络和电脑网络在同一个局域网内1、打开Jmeter,在测试计划上点右键新建进程,名为:APP录制脚本;2、在工作台上右键,新建HTTP代理服务器,设置端口号为8888(Jmeter新建一个守护进程,监... 查看详情

jmeter利用自身代理录制脚本

...定要安装javajdk,不然不能录制的。没有安装过javajdk安装jmeter后打开时会提示安装jdk,但是mac系统中直接打开提示安装jdk页面后下载的java并不是jdk(windows中没有试验过,笔者所说的基本全部指的是在mac系统中操作的)。所以要... 查看详情

jmeter之https脚本录制

jmeter录制脚本时,跟http脚本录制主要区别是,https录制需要添加安全证书。 一、jmeter代理服务器及证书配置。1、打开jmeter,右键测试计划添加线程组,右键工作台-->非测试元件-->http代理服务器2、设置http代理服务器。... 查看详情

jmeter4.0----录制脚本

1.前言 Jmeter录制脚本有两种方式。1.通过第三方工具录制比如:Badboy,然后转化为jmeter可用的脚本;2.使用jmeter本身自带的录制脚本功能。 对于测试小白来说可用先使用jmeter录制脚本,熟悉jmeter工具的使用,以及jmeter基本... 查看详情

使用jmeter录制脚本

...,这时候问开发拿接口和参数就会降低工作效率,直接用jmeter的录制功能就能提高工作效率2、开发接口案例中,我们也经常会碰到一些上传、下载、导入等等一些接口功能,这些脚本如果直接问开发拿接口和参数也不方便,直... 查看详情

jmeter之录制脚本

  LoadRunner有录制脚本的功能,Jmeter想必也是有的。(之前看的工具对比中,貌似就LR中的IP欺骗是Jmeter不具有的,转而用其他方式实现的。),Jmeter录制脚本常用的有两种方式:一、利用代理录制1、创建一个线程组鼠标右键点... 查看详情

使用jmeter录制脚本并调试

仍然以禅道中添加bug为例进行录制第一步:在JMeter中添加线程组,命名为AddBugByJMeter第二步:在线程组下添加HTTP请求默认值添加->配置元件->HTTP请求默认值,设置服务器IP和端口号(JMeter默认使用80端口号,我的禅道配置的是... 查看详情

jmeter怎么使用httpproxy方式录制

一、JMeter有一个内置的代理服务器,主要用户使用浏览器录制脚本,在左侧的WorkBench中添加HTTPProxyServer即可,其中port表示代理服务器段口号,URLPatternstoExclude表示需要过滤得文件,录制脚本时不进行捕捉方式是".*\\.css",引号内的... 查看详情

jmeter脚本录制

1.1. 使用第三方录制方式或代理录制方式(建议) 第三方采用:http://www.badboy.com.au/ 通过badboy来录制,录制后另存为jmx格式即可。操作步骤:a、打开badboy软件,默认打开是Recording状态,即录制状态,如果要停止录制点... 查看详情

jmeter使用流程及简单分析监控

录制Jmeter脚本录制Jmeter脚本有两种方法,一种是设置代理;一种则是利用badboy软件,badboy软件支持导出jmx脚本。这里我们介绍第二种方法,利用badboy录制脚本,然后导出Jmeter需要的jmx文件。首先,在地址栏中输入要录制脚本的地... 查看详情